Abstract | PURPOSE: We examined the expression profile of the members of the pancreatitis associated proteins/regenerating gene family in the bladder and in the primary afferent neurons of dorsal root ganglia using an animal model of cystitis. MATERIALS AND METHODS: RESULTS: CONCLUSIONS:
